When an application requires mfc110.dll, Windows will check the application and system folders for this .dll file. If the file is missing you may receive an error and the application may not function properly. Learn how to re-install mfc110.dll.

`mfc110u.dll` is a dynamic link library (DLL) file associated with the Microsoft Foundation Class (MFC) Library, specifically from Microsoft® Visual Studio® 2012.
